Learn about the best practices for concurrency in Java to ensure your multi-threaded applications are efficient, synchronized, and error-free. Concurrency in Java is the ability of multiple threads to ...
BOGOR, Indonesia — In a village bordering Gunung Halimun-Salak National Park on the Indonesian island of Java, local people browse a row of fabrics carrying impressions of plants and the silhouette of ...
With the advent of AI-mediated APIs, the era of manually hard-coding every integration between every microservice may be ...
LLVM powers the core development tools, operating systems, and most applications at Apple Computer, where it long ago ...
Picture a pile of trash the size of Manhattan and taller than one and a half Empire State Buildings. That’s how much plastic waste the world is predicted to be generating every year by 2050 if nothing ...
Abstract: This paper presents FUNDED (Flow-sensitive vUl-Nerability coDE Detection), a novel learning framework for building vulnerability detection models. Funded leverages the advances in graph ...
The Java Community Process formally launches development of Java SE 28, with Project Valhalla once again positioned as the release's most closely watched feature.
Ensuring students are ready for the future means striking a balance between foundational learning, digital fluency and ...
Microsoft Edge 149 removed Collections. Here’s what users can still recover, what may be missing, and what IT teams should check after the update.
Matrix structures don’t work on their own. The work is less about control and more about integration, often without formal ...
JPMorgan Chase is giving the business world an early look at what happens when AI agents move beyond experiments and start ...
Researchers who study what divides people also have the tools to explore strategies to unite them.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results